Used BMW cars for sale in Witham, Essex

Loading...
Make (any)
Model (any)
Min price (any)
Max price (any)

Find your perfect used BMW car for sale in Witham or buy on finance from our extensive local network of car supermarkets, specialist, independent and officially franchised BMW dealerships.

BMW, 5 Series

2015 (15) - 2.0 525d M Sport Touring Auto Euro 6 (s/s) 5dr

70
£12,990
Finance available £268 pm
  • 2L
  • 88.9kMiles
  • Diesel
  • Auto
  • Body StyleEstate

DAXTER LIMITED

BMW, X4

2021 - X4 xDrive30d M Sport 5-Door

61
£31,500
Finance available £627 pm
  • 3L
  • 43.7kMiles
  • Hybrid
  • Auto
  • Body StyleEstate

Saxton 4x4

01245 202306 *
4.4/5 Stars

BMW, 5 Series

(14) - 2.0 520d M Sport Touring Auto Euro 6 (s/s) 5dr

31
£7,900
Finance available £154 pm
  • 128kMiles
  • Diesel
  • Auto

Browns Car Company

01621 733495 *
4.4/5 Stars

BMW, 4 Series

2016 - 420d [190] Sport 5dr Auto [Business Media]

100
Low Mileage
£12,490
Finance available £257 pm
  • 2L
  • 73kMiles
  • Diesel
  • Auto
  • Body StyleHatchback

Peverel car company ltd

BMW, 1 Series

2011 (61) - 2.0 118d M Sport Euro 5 (s/s) 3dr

28
£2,600
  • 2L
  • 125kMiles
  • Diesel
  • Manual
  • Body StyleHatchback

Max Bradley Cars

BMW, 4 Series

2022 - 2.0 420d MHT M Sport Pro Edition Auto xDrive Euro 6 (s/s) 2dr

60
Low Mileage
£33,700
Finance available £672 pm
  • 2L
  • 7.5kMiles
  • Hybrid
  • Auto
  • Body StyleCoupe

Saxton 4x4

01245 202306 *
4.4/5 Stars

BMW, 4 Series

2018 (68) - 3.0 440i GPF M Sport Auto Euro 6 (s/s) 2dr

28
£20,000
Finance available £390 pm
  • 3L
  • 55k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

Browns Car Company

01621 733495 *
4.4/5 Stars

BMW, 3 Series

2023 - 3.0 M340i MHT Auto xDrive Euro 6 (s/s) 4dr

61
Low Mileage
£42,700
Finance available £857 pm
  • 3L
  • 7.2kMiles
  • Hybrid
  • Auto
  • Body StyleSaloon

Saxton 4x4

01245 202306 *
4.4/5 Stars

BMW, 3 Series

2020 (70) - 2.0 330e 12kWh M Sport Auto Euro 6 (s/s) 4dr

32
£15,300
Finance available £320 pm
  • 2L
  • 108kMiles
  • Hybrid
  • Auto
  • Body StyleSaloon

Browns Car Company

01621 733495 *
4.4/5 Stars

BMW, M140i

2017 (67) - 3.0 M140i Hatchback 5dr Petrol Auto Euro 6 (s/s) (340 ps)

35
£16,495
Finance available £346 pm
  • 3L
  • 75kMiles
  • Petrol
  • Auto
  • Body StyleHatchback

Hudson Autos

BMW, X5

2017 (17) - 3.0 30d M Sport Auto xDrive Euro 6 (s/s) 5dr

33
Reduced
£20,800
Finance available £407 pm
  • 3L
  • 86kMiles
  • Diesel
  • Auto
  • Body StyleSUV

Browns Car Company

01621 733495 *
4.4/5 Stars

BMW, 5 Series

2023 - 530e M Sport Touring 5-Door

61
£31,000
Finance available £616 pm
  • 2L
  • 31.3kMiles
  • Hybrid
  • Auto
  • Body StyleEstate

Saxton 4x4

01245 202306 *
4.4/5 Stars

BMW, X5

2021 - 3.0 30d MHT M Sport Auto xDrive Euro 6 (s/s) 5dr

61
Low Mileage
£42,200
Finance available £846 pm
  • 3L
  • 26.2kMiles
  • Hybrid
  • Auto
  • Body StyleSUV

Saxton 4x4

01245 202306 *
4.4/5 Stars

BMW, 5 Series

2023 - 530e M Sport Touring 5-Door

61
£32,100
Finance available £639 pm
  • 2L
  • 23.6kMiles
  • Hybrid
  • Auto
  • Body StyleEstate

Saxton 4x4

01245 202306 *
4.4/5 Stars

BMW, X4

2022 - X4 M Competition 5-Door

61
£53,200
Finance available £1072 pm
  • 3L
  • 35.2kMiles
  • Petrol
  • Auto
  • Body StyleEstate

Saxton 4x4

01245 202306 *
4.4/5 Stars

BMW, 3 Series

2021 - M340i xDrive Saloon 4-Door

61
£31,650
Finance available £630 pm
  • 3L
  • 31.9kMiles
  • Hybrid
  • Auto
  • Body StyleSaloon

Saxton 4x4

01245 202306 *
4.4/5 Stars